Does your home business sell used books? You can sell books on many websites for profit. You'll likely want to utilize multiple sites. Assess how well these companies do their jobs. Rate them for customer service, how reliable they are and how quick they deliver. Compare the prices offered on different sites to make sure you will be competitive. To get the best service, you may end up having to spend more.

Before starting a home business take time to learn as much as possible about small businesses. There is a lot of information on this topic. The US Small Business Administration is a great place to start. You can visit them at www.sba.gov. There is a whole section devoted to home business.

Begin a business that you know will profit. Check out the current market and see if it is over-saturated. An over saturated market with lots of providers is really difficult for a new company to break into and be successful. Conduct a financial analysis prior to starting.
